Transaction 3a58c16c41cddc7aa1a1040acbbd6be2c2644d063ad6c2671826af94822dfd44

1 Input
1 Outputs
  • 3a58c16c41cddc7aa1a1040acbbd6be2c2644d063ad6c2671826af94822dfd44:0
  • value  507210
    address  14iDbWoqCwXjJ4odRfT29uJaH1pVnwDaUx